Bug Description
Worked fine in Hardy. Neither Network Manager nor manual configuration works. After setting up manual config and restarting newtorking, the error is SIOCADDRT: No such process
Failed to bring up eth1.
Also have Intel 82801G on the motherboard and NM will take control of it and claim it's connected, but still no network. Can't even ping boxes on the same network.
